Output 1838aecef6b072b47031b0679f791c910d0b380af03c30d4b3d4aa7d721e0be3:2

value
106307458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f135010aec3e02b94592bd1e105eb918aed72a OP_EQUAL
address
MMfGYZgDe3aMpxyBpfgqreLN6ibZXSPmYr
transaction
1838aecef6b072b47031b0679f791c910d0b380af03c30d4b3d4aa7d721e0be3
spent
true